Indulging on a nice New Orleans snow day (you read correctly), I thought to try this place for lunch and was rather disappointed. Service-wise, it was one of the least hospitable welcomes I've received in a city known for hospitality, but nothing in substance really made up for it.
I ordered something called a "vegan chicken shawarma" out of curiosity. This was perhaps my mistake; the thing wasn't really to my taste and had an off taste that had me checking to ensure it wasn't actual chicken. Maybe that appeals to some people, but it didn't to me. The real problem was that the menu listed it as coming with fries and hummus, which I expected meant separate sides of the above (certainly for the price), but this amounted to a small smear of hummus inside the sandwich, and a total of eight fries on top, delivering a "that's it?" experience.
Moreover, I was struck that the next guy who came in ordered the same thing as me and had essentially the same experience, as far as I could tell. Notably, he asked what the vegan chicken was and received an answer of "seitan, which is soybeans". This is obviously inaccurate and didn't inspire much confidence. On the plus side, they had some free bread out as an appetizer, with some very nice toppings that far exceeded the tastiness of what I actually ordered. I could see maybe trying something else from them someday, but it won't be soon.
